The Good, the Bad and the Villain celebrates 12 years.
For twelve years, the night has had an address — and it doesn’t seem willing to change.
On Rua do Alecrim, The Villain remains that meeting point between smoke, music, and stories told in half-tones.
On November 7th and 8th, another year of Villainy is celebrated. Two nights that aren’t quite a party — they’re tradition.
On Friday, November 7th, the atmosphere takes on a new shape. Grande Cabaret Lisboa steps onto the stage with two performers, the bar turns to velvet and shadow, and burlesque takes over the room.
After that, Nuno Lopes takes control of the decks. Those who know him already know what happens: energy, rhythm, and the feeling that the night ends only when he says so.
On Saturday, November 8th, it’s time for the house to play its own sound. Filipe Parada and Luís Patraquim bring back the music that has always belonged to The Villain — beats that mix with glasses, laughter, and the quiet noise of people who’ve been coming back for years. It’s the right ending: intimate, familiar, and shining with the house’s own silver.
